首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Insert into table with多个select,包括select distinct from from

是一种在数据库中执行插入操作的语法。它允许我们从多个源表中选择数据,并将其插入到目标表中。

具体的语法如下:

代码语言:txt
复制
INSERT INTO 目标表 (列1, 列2, 列3, ...)
SELECT DISTINCT 列1, 列2, 列3, ...
FROM 源表1, 源表2, ...

其中,目标表是要插入数据的表,列1、列2、列3等是目标表中的列名。源表1、源表2等是要从中选择数据的源表。

使用SELECT DISTINCT关键字可以确保插入的数据中没有重复的行。

这种语法的优势在于可以方便地从多个表中选择数据并插入到目标表中,减少了手动操作的复杂性。

应用场景:

  • 数据合并:当需要将多个表中的数据合并到一个表中时,可以使用这种语法。
  • 数据筛选:通过在SELECT语句中添加条件,可以筛选出符合特定条件的数据进行插入。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云数据库SQL Server:https://cloud.tencent.com/product/cdb_sqlserver
  • 腾讯云数据库PostgreSQL:https://cloud.tencent.com/product/cdb_postgresql

请注意,以上链接仅供参考,具体选择产品应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

9分1秒

尚硅谷-14-最基本的SELECT...FROM结构

领券